Hong Kong Pork Stew

2 pounds boneless pork shoulder -- cubed

1 teaspoon salt

1/4 teaspoon ground ginger

1/8 teaspoon pepper

13 ounces canned pineapple chunks

1/4 cup firmly packed brown sugar

1 teaspoon chicken broth -- instant

1/4 cup molasses

1/4 cup vinegar

2 tablespoons cornstarch

16 ounces sweet potatoes -- or canned

2 tomatoes -- cut in 1/8

1 green pepper -- cut in 1" cubes

Trim excess fat from meat. Place in crock pot and season with salt, ginger and pepper. Drain syrup from pineeapple and add water to make 1 1/2 cups. Reserve chunks. Add syrup to pork, stir in sugar, chicken broth, molasses and vinegar. Cover and cook on low for 8 hours or high for 4 hours. Turn heat to high. Combine cornstarch and 1/4 cup cold water. Stir into pork mixture and blend well. Add cooked sweet potatoes, tomatoes, pineapple chunks and green peppers. Simmer 20 mins. until thickened and vegetables are heated through.
